925 N Anchor Way
Portland, OR 97217
$24.00 USD/SF/YR
1,600-2,300 SF
2
Spaces Available
Built 2004
2,300 SF Contiguous
Built 2004
1,600-2,300 SF
$24.00 USD/SF/YR
Retail